The Organization for Security and Co-operation in Europe (OSCE) invites you to apply for the second edition of the EmPOWER Local Women Politicians Programme. If you are an elected woman leader working at the local level and/or woman activist involved in local policy and decision-making processes related to gender equality and women empowerment, and if you are looking to advance your career and most importantly, be an agent of change – this programme is for you.
The seven-month programme focuses on developing political leadership skills and is open to women holding an elected seat at the municipal assemblies Kosovo-wide and/or women activists involved in local policy and decision-making processes related to gender equality and women empowerment.All parts of the programme are based on equity, equality, participation, transparency and accountability, and the goal is to strengthen public and political participation and representation, primarily by empowering participants themselves, as well as building their capacities to get a higher involvement in decision-making processes and jointly advocate for a shared objective.
The aim of the programme is to:
- Enable the participants to improve their leadership skills;
- Help the participants to recognize, and fully utilize their transformative potential, and maximize their role as agents of change;
- Encourage and strengthen participants’ political initiative,participation and effectiveness of their engagement;
- Give participants access to a network of women politicians/activists Kosovo-wide.

Structure and Topics
- The seven-month long programme consists of four compulsory workshop and training sessions, that will be tentatively held as follows:May, June/July,September,October and November (tentatively on the rst Saturday of the month from 10 AM – 15 PM,with the exception of a two day summer camp in June/July).The workshops will take place in Prishtinë/Priština,while the venue of the summer camp has to be determined and will be communicated to participants in due time.
- In addition, based on their needs, participants will be provided with a one-on-one online personal mentoring and coaching session with a relevant trainer.
- The workshops/training/coaching sessions will be delivered by an international consultant, while simultaneous interpreting will be provided when necessary. The EmPOWER participants will have the opportunity to expand their knowledge on issues related to women empowerment,including:
- Self-condence building;
- Political visual identity;
- Public speaking and debating;
- Time management;
- Partnership building and advocacy;
- Gender mainstreaming;
- How to turn commitments into actions.
